Shekarau loses five-month-old daughter

BY Ebunoluwa Olafusi

Share

Ibrahim Shekarau, a former governor of Kano state, has lost his five-month-old daughter.

The five-month-old girl reportedly died on Monday in a hospital in Dubai, and has been buried in that country.

Sule Yau Sule, special adviser to Shekarau, broke the news in a statement.

“On a sad note, we wish to announce the death of the youngest daughter of His Excellency, Senator Ibrahim Shekarau, a five-month-old baby who died today,” the statement reads.

“She was already buried in Dubai where she was hospitalised.”

Shekarau, who is the senator representing Kano central, was a former Nigerian minister of education and two-term governor of Kano.

Shekarau was governor of Kano between 2003 and 2011, and contested the presidential election in 2011.

He left the All Progressives Congress (APC) in 2014 for the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P), citing “a lack of transparency and accountability” in the ruling party.

The former governor had said his decision was to satisfy the aspirations of the people of Kano who felt disenfranchised.

But in 2018, he returned to the ruling party.
